Asbestosis is a progressive irreversible and fatal disease

 

 

 

 

Asbestosis is an interstitial fibrotic chronic disease that can be caused by occupational exposure to asbestos. Asbestosis symptoms include shortness of breath, coughing and irregular heart rhythms and breath shortness. It's also a warning sign of the development of pleural mesothelioma, the lung cancer that forms in the lung's lining.

 

 

 

 

If you have an asbestos-related history it is essential to undergo several tests to confirm your diagnosis. These tests include X-rays and CT scans that can detect asbestosis at a very early stage. In addition the biopsy of tissue from the lung is recommended to confirm.

 

 

 

 

Asbestosis is a serious lung disease that causes scarring and inflammation. The lungs also become honeycomb-shaped due to scarring. Because the lungs are inflamed, they have difficulty absorption of oxygen into the bloodstream.

 

 

 

 

Asbestosis sufferers are at a higher risk of developing bronchitis or pneumonia. They also have an increased risk of developing heart disease. They may also develop chronic obstructive pulmonary disease (COPD), which can cause a decline in the lung's ability and carbon dioxide exchange.

 

 

 

 

There is no cure for asbestosis, but there are treatments to help control the disease. Treatments include breathing therapies, medication, and exercise. These treatments can relieve chest pain and shortness of breath. Regular exercise can also help improve lung function.

 

 

 

 

Asbestosis sufferers should eat a healthy diet and exercise regularly. They also need to be aware of air pollution and smoking. They should also consult their doctor regarding vaccinations.

 

 

 

 

Lung transplants are typically regarded as a last resort option for advanced asbestosis. To ensure the success of the transplant patients must undergo extensive screening. They also must undergo various antirejection medications.

The typical treatment for mesothelioma consists of surgery, chemotherapy, radiation therapy and immunotherapy. These treatments reduce symptoms and slow down the growth of cancer and enhance the quality of your life. The patient can also opt to take part in clinical trials to study new treatments and drugs.

 

 

 

 

In the course of treatment, a medical oncologist will determine the best method of treatment. They will decide if surgery, chemotherapy, or radiation therapy is the best option for the patient.

 

 

 

 

The treatment plan is based on the cancer's stage, the patient's age, and the patient's general health. Other treatments could be added to enhance the quality and quantity of life.

 

 

 

 

Surgery can be used to aid in the removal of part of the lung's lining or the removal of a tumor. The surgeons can also utilize chemotherapy and radiation therapy to enhance the effectiveness of surgery.

 

 

 

 

Chemotherapy can be administered to the bloodstream or directly to the abdomen. This can reduce the number and death of cancer cells. The chemotherapy is used to destroy cancer cells by attacking them fast. This can be done before surgery or after surgery.

 

 

 

 

Surgery can also be used to remove the lymph nodes that are affected by the cancer. The use of radiation therapy is to kill cancerous cells if they have spread to the chest, neck, or the face. This treatment is also used in conjunction with chemotherapy.

 

 

 

 

Combining immunotherapy and surgery could be accomplished. Immunotherapy uses the immune systems to fight cancer. The treatment has been proved to be effective in treating different types of cancer. The aim of immunotherapy is to slow the growth of cancer by altering the way the immune system works.
